Danny "Dano" L. McClintock Sr.

1952 ∼ 2017

Danny Lynn McClintock, Sr. “Dano”, 64, of Port Arthur, passed away peacefully on July 1, 2017. Danny was born on December 19, 1952 in Port Arthur to the late Louis McClintock and Therese Provost McClintock. He graduated in 1972 from Bishop Byrne High School in Port Arthur. Afterwards, he attended electrical trade school and worked construction jobs over the years until he found his career at Veolia in 1989 where he was still employed. During his many years there, Danny made lots of great memories and lifelong friendships. Danny was a devoted and loving husband, father and grandfather. He loved nothing more than being surrounded by his family while grilling and watching the Dallas Cowboys or Houston Astros.

Danny is survived by his loving wife of 40 years, Georgia McClintock of Port Arthur; sons, Danny McClintock, Jr. and wife, Katy McClintock of Port Neches and Eric McClintock of Nederland; grandchildren, his best friend, Chase McClintock and his sweetheart, Kayla McClintock; brothers, Michael McClintock and wife, Mary McClintock of Baton Rouge, LA, Kelly McClintock and wife, Debbie McClintock of Port Arthur and Rev. Jim McClintock of Fannett and a host of dearly loved nieces and nephews. He is preceded in death by his parents; sister, Christy McClintock Gamage of Port Arthur and his grandparents.

There will be gathering of family and friends on Wednesday, July 5, 2017 from 6:00 p.m. to 8:00 p.m. at Melancon’s Funeral Home in Nederland with a rosary at 5:00 p.m. prayed by Father Jim McClintock. A Mass of Christian Burial will be on Thursday, July 6, 2017 at St. Elizabeth Catholic Church in Port Neches at 10:00 a.m. with Rev. Jim McClintock, Celebrant. The interment will be at Oak Bluff Memorial Park in Port Neches.
